Federal Agencies Defer Rule Requiring Crediting Drug Coupons towards Health Plan Cost Sharing
Under new guidance issued on August 26, 2019, the three federal agencies charged with implementing the Affordable Care Act have announced they will not enforce a rule requiring the crediting of drug manufacturer coupons towards health plan annual...
